Mary Halvorson's Trio's Debut CD, Dragon's Head, Released Today on Firehouse 12 Records

Mary Halvorson
Firehouse 12 Records is proud to announce the October 28th release of Dragon's Head (FH12-04-01-007), guitarist/composer Mary Halvorson's debut recording as a bandleader.

Recorded in February at the label's state of the art studio in New Haven, it features ten new original compositions written specifically for her working trio with bassist John Hebert and drummer Ches Smith. She has previously composed music for recordings with her chamber music duo with violist Jessica Pavone and the avant-rock duo, People, with drummer Kevin Shea, but this is her first release alone at the helm of her own ensemble.

“A singular talent," writes AllAboutJazz.com reviewer Troy Collins, “Brooklyn-based guitarist Mary Halvorson has come into her own as a composer and improviser with her trio debut, Dragon's Head...light years ahead of her peers, she is the most impressive guitarist of her generation. The future of jazz guitar starts here."

The All Music Guide's Michael G. Nastos adds, “It is an auspicious outing in that her style within the modern creative improvised idiom leaves little doubt as to her immense talent, and resounds in a listener's head with a sense of both bewilderment and satisfaction."

Critics have called Ms. Halvorson “immediately distinctive" (Brian Morton, Jazz Review), “consistently one of the most fascinating and satisfying guitarists in town" (Time Out New York) and “a thoughtful and increasingly prominent presence on the avant-garde landscape" (Nate Chinen, New York Times). “She plays guitar in a way that fractures conventions," declared Steve Dollar in the New York Sun, “restlessly inventing her own paradigms."

A veteran of the ensembles of esteemed saxophonist/composer Anthony Braxton, as well as such working groups as Trevor Dunn's Trio-Convulsant and the Taylor Ho Bynum Trio/Sextet, Ms. Halvorson has been active in New York since 2000, following jazz studies at Wesleyan University and the New School. She has also performed alongside Nels Cline, Tony Malaby, Jason Moran, Joe Morris, Oscar Noriega, Andrea Parkins, Marc Ribot, Elliott Sharp and John Tchicai. In addition to her trio, and duos with Pavone and Shea, she performs regularly in ensembles led by Jason Cady, Brian Chase, Curtis Hasselbring, Tatsuya Nakatani, Ted Reichman and Matthew Welch.
